As 1979 drew to a close, Paul McCartney organized a series of concerts at the Hammersmith Odeon in London, to raise money for the victims of war torn Camboda. Dubbed the Concerts for the People of Kampuchea, the 4 shows, from January 26 to 29, featured Queen, The Clash, The Pretenders, The Who, Elvis Costello, Rockpile and Wings, just to name a few of the acts that performed. The penultimate night, December 28, 1979, 4 decades  ago today, as captured in this soundboard recording, featured The Who, completing their first year of touring with Kenny Jones on drums, who had replaced Keith Moon.  Moon had passed away just a little over a year earlier from an overdose.
